HEQQ vs VYM Performance

JPMorgan Nasdaq Hedged Equity Laddered Overlay ETF (HEQQ) is an ETF from J.P. Morgan Asset Management and Vanguard High Dividend Yield ETF (VYM) is an ETF from Vanguard (US). Over the past year HEQQ returned +10.28% while VYM returned +20.84%. Year to date, HEQQ is up 5.12% versus a gain of 14.82% for VYM.

Risk: Volatility and Drawdowns

VYM has been the more volatile fund, with annualized monthly volatility of 9.3% compared with 8.4% for HEQQ. Lower volatility generally means a smoother ride, though it often comes with lower long-run returns.

The deepest peak-to-trough decline in our data was -7.6% for HEQQ and -11.3% for VYM. Drawdown depth is what each fund did in the worst stretch of the window measured above.

The two funds' monthly returns correlate at 0.52. They move together some of the time, and apart the rest.

Fees and Cost Over Time

HEQQ charges 0.50% per year while VYM charges 0.04%. On a $10,000 position that is $50 vs $4 annually, a gap of $46 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, HEQQ currently yields 0.22% against 2.24% for VYM.

Holdings Overlap

HEQQ already in VYM15.4%
VYM already in HEQQ28.9%

15.4% of HEQQ's money is in holdings VYM also owns. 28.9% of VYM's money is in holdings HEQQ also owns.

VYM and HEQQ share little of their money.

29 positions in common, counted across the 98 positions we hold weights for in HEQQ and 603 in VYM, against full books of 108 and 613.

What only one of them owns

Our book lists 541 positions for VYM that do not appear in our book for HEQQ (68.5% of the fund), and 64 for HEQQ that do not appear in VYM (82.0%).

Some of those will be the same company recorded under a different code in one of the two books, so the real difference in what you would own is no larger than this and may be smaller. We do not name the individual positions here for that reason.
